#9604db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9604db is composed of 58.8% red, 1.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.5%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 280.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 43.7%. #9604db color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#2d00b7.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#9604db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9604db has RGB values of R:150, G:4,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 9831643.

Shades and Tints of #9604db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050007 is the darkest color, while #fbf3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9604db
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716b74 is the less saturated color, while #9604db is the most saturated one.
